Job Summary
As part of the BusinessIntelligence team, this data professional will partner with business leaders across the organization to surface key metrics and unlock vital insights that drive data-informed decisions and guide business strategy. This is an individual capable of leveraging database technologies, mathematical savvy, and analytical tools to turn data into answers and insights.
Purpose/Impact: (Duties & Essential Functions)
Product & Initiative Leadership
Identify different options to solve for requested features or analyses and propose solutions considering trade-offs on cost, scalability, supportability, and usability.
Performance Expectations
Regularly weighs several factors beyond the analytics realm when recommending solutions or approaches. Deeply understands the implementation context and user perspective.
Has a sufficiently large toolkit of prior experience and understanding of analytical approaches to generate alternative ideas.
Reporting & Analytics
Conduct exploratory analysis needed to substantiate or frame analytics solutions for major business questions or product features. Includes the use of non-governed data.
Analyze business questions and communicate findings through briefs, presentations, reports or other media. Clarify and document the questions, how findings may be used, and the analysis approach.
Develop complex deterministic models as well as probabilistic models enabling the business to make decisions considering potential and likely outcomes.
Conduct impact analysis of business performance, identifying an appropriate approach to break down and explain performance based on internal and external contributing factors, trends and patterns.
Develop reports and dashboards for an entire problem space, such as website performance, lead conversion or studio portfolio analysis. These are product features that are supported and evolved over time as opposed to one-off analyses.
Develop end-user applications with low-code tools to surface actionable analytics insights, collect data or execute analytics-driven workflows/actions.
Work with data engineers to create new datasets, providing requirements and use cases, and jointly analyzing the suitability of source data.
Performance Expectations
Uses a toolkit of analytical methods that includes (when appropriate!) basic statistical concepts, such as statistical significance, distributions, independent and dependent probabilities, confidence intervals etc. to answer business questions.
Conveys to business stakeholders how to apply probabilistic answers to their business decisions.
Able to ask questions to fully understand the context and business question asked and how answering it will make a difference.
Identifies key assumptions around perceived or real business problems and validates them before proceeding with the analysis.
Makes accurate inferences from data. Knows what the data says and what it doesn't say and is transparent about shortcomings of the data. Suggests further analysis paths if answer is not sufficiently conclusive.
Shows interest and can speak the language of the business domain they are supporting (e.g., marketing, finance, operations). When presenting findings business stakeholders follow.
Is recognized by business stakeholders as their analytics partner whom they can rely on for developing data-informed insights.
Participates in creating reporting and analytics standards, identifying, coaching, and teaching analysis methods. Is sought out by other analysts for advice.
Knows the principles of dataset design and independently works with data engineers to ensure the datasets from domain data to published datasets will meet all current or planned use cases.

How much does a business intelligence analyst earn in Apple Valley, MN?
The average business intelligence analyst in Apple Valley, MN earns between $57,000 and $100,000 annually. This compares to the national average business intelligence analyst range of $59,000 to $107,000.
Average business intelligence analyst salary in Apple Valley, MN
$75,000
